Output 73ce8df697121041f4560e09b9778b99e1bfdb2f991e6eedcc23841b34b418c5:13

value
18830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01924a2a9cbd033a3a772f22c1053be9d2e2d306 OP_EQUAL
address
31qKr865mf5XzR82RhqDwt7zBXdthemV2J
transaction
73ce8df697121041f4560e09b9778b99e1bfdb2f991e6eedcc23841b34b418c5
confirmations
296366
spent
true